WANGANUI STOCK REPORT.
■ — '— ""•! * MR FREEMAN B. JACKSON'S FORTNIGHTLY STOCK: REPORT. • Thursday, December 27. I do not anticipate any further advance m \ihe price of stock 1 during the -summer month?. Store cattle at present values leave a fair margin for fattening, and, with a possible rise diring the wintertfor fat, they should be a good investment at ihe rates now ruling. The holidays inter* 1 fered somewhat with the sale to day, though I succeeded m placing all the cattle and tbe bulk of the sheep after the auction, fcheep showed a slight downward tendency at the sale to- day. The ] following, are quotations at the St Hill Said Yards. -. Cattle.- Fat bullocks, L 5 to L 6 7s 6d ; steers, L 3; heifers, L 2 ss; cowe,.L2 2a.6d; yearlings, ' ■ . ■ Sheep.— Fat ewes made 10s 3d to 10s 6d j ewes and wethers, 9s 6d j wethers m wool, l&s':'- ewes and lambs, 103 6d. Horses.— No alteration m values. A few found purchasers at. current rates,
